  • **Where you stay ** - "Where you live"
  • your people will be my people - "I will consider the people of your country as being my own people" or "I will consider your relatives as my own relatives."
  • May Yahweh punish me, and even more, if - This was a common Jewish expression that means "I ask God to punish me if I do not do what I say." Many languages have idioms with similar meanings that could be used here. AT: "God forbid!" (See: en:ta:vol1:translate:figs_idiom)
